, car dealerships have actually traditionally been an important source of state and local sales tax obligations. By 2010, all US states had laws that forbade suppliers from side-stepping independent automobile dealers and offering cars directly to customers.
Today, direct sales by a car manufacturer to consumers are limited by most states in the united state with franchise business best site legislations that call for new cars to be offered just by licensed and bound, individually possessed car dealerships. The first lady car dealership in the USA was Rachel "Mother" Krouse who in 1903 opened her company, Krouse Electric motor Auto Company,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.

Audi has trying out a hi-tech display room that enables clients to configure and experience cars and trucks on 1:1 range digital screens. In markets where it is permitted, Mercedes-Benz opened up city centre brand name stores. Tesla Motors has rejected the dealership sales version based upon the idea that dealerships do not properly explain the benefits of their cars and trucks, and they might not depend on third-party dealerships to manage their sales.

The franchisor can act opportunistically by enforcing restrictions and burden on the franchisee after the last has incurred sunk costs, such as spending in physical possessions and developing a credibility with customers. The franchisor can for example call for that autos be marketed at small cost, and services be performed for little compensation.

Auto dealerships have lobbied for laws that increase the survival and earnings of vehicle dealerships: By 2010, all US states had laws that prohibited makers from side-stepping independent vehicle dealers and offering autos to customers directly. By 2009, a lot of states enforced restrictions on the development of brand-new dealers to take on incumbent dealers.
Many states stop suppliers from involving in "amount requiring" wherein suppliers call for that dealers purchase vehicles that they had not purchased. A lot of states restrict the capability of makers to differentiate in between automobile suppliers (for example, by providing far better terms to large cars and truck suppliers with economies of scale or dealers that provide far better consumer service).
